The QuipSonic Toothbrush for Kids is an innovative electric toothbrush designed to promote healthy oral habits in children. Featuring a 2-minute timer, a small replaceable brush head, and gentle sonic vibrations, it ensures a thorough clean while being easy to use. With a travel-friendly design and a battery life of up to three months, this toothbrush is perfect for busy families looking to instill good dental hygiene in their kids.
